AI Technical Summary

Technical Problem

Due to memory decline and mobility issues, older adults often find it difficult to take multiple medications on time, and existing medication management tools cannot effectively address the problems of medication mix-ups and missed doses.

Method used

A smart reminder and automatic medicine dispensing device has been designed, including a medicine tray rack and a receiving reminder component. The medicine tray rack is driven by a motor to rotate and dispense medicine according to time. It is equipped with a speaker for voice reminders. Combined with a receiving slot and a permanent magnet, it ensures that the medicine bottle is placed stably and the reminders are accurate.

Benefits of technology

It enables automatic and timely medication delivery with voice reminders, preventing elderly people from forgetting to take their medication or taking medications incorrectly, thus improving the intelligence level of medication management and the convenience of home care.

Description

Technical Field

[0001] This utility model relates to the field of medication management technology, specifically to a device that can provide intelligent reminders and automatically dispense medication. Background Technology

[0002] The health problems of the elderly population are receiving increasing attention from society. For the elderly, daily medication becomes a problem due to memory decline and mobility issues. Many elderly patients need to take multiple medications, which often need to be taken at different times of the day. However, due to memory loss and mobility difficulties, the elderly often have difficulty taking their medications on time or easily confuse medications that should be taken at different times. This not only affects the treatment effect but may also lead to increased drug side effects and even serious health risks.

[0003] While existing medication management tools such as pillboxes and alarm clocks can help seniors manage their medications to some extent, they still have shortcomings in practical use. For example, traditional pillboxes cannot distinguish between medications taken at different times, and simple alarm clocks cannot solve the problem of seniors forgetting which medication to take even after hearing the reminder. Therefore, we provide a smart reminder and automatic medication dispensing device. Utility Model Content

[0030] Example 1: Please refer to Figure 1 and Figure 3This utility model provides an intelligent reminder and automatic medicine dispensing device, including a device body, a medicine tray rack 4, and a reminder receiving component. The device body has a base 1 and a medicine storage cavity 2 fixed at a predetermined height above the base 1. The medicine storage cavity 2 has a medicine dispensing port 3 on the side facing the base 1. The medicine tray rack 4 is located in the medicine storage cavity 2 and is driven to rotate by a motor 5. The motor 5 is configured to start and stop within a predetermined time period. The starting and stopping of the motor 5 can be specifically controlled by a time control switch 21. The time control switch 21 can control the time of each start and stop of the motor 5, thereby controlling the rotation angle of the motor 5. The medicine tray 4 is provided with multiple medicine storage holes 6 corresponding to the position of the medicine outlet 3 and capable of holding medicine bottles 20. The multiple medicine storage holes 6 are arranged in a circular array on the medicine tray 4. Each medicine storage hole 6 can hold one medicine bottle 20. After the medicine bottle 20 is placed in the medicine storage hole 6, the bottom of the medicine bottle 20 is supported on the inner bottom surface of the medicine storage cavity 2. The receiving reminder component includes a receiving plate 8 elastically connected to the base 1, a button switch 9 disposed between the receiving plate 8 and the base 1, and a speaker 10 electrically connected to the button switch 9. The receiving plate 8 can be elastically connected to the base 1 through a spring 11 or other elastic element.

[0031] Using the above-described medication dispensing device, the elderly person's guardian or family member can pre-place the required dose of medication in one medicine bottle 20. Multiple medicine bottles 20 contain medications corresponding to different dosage times in the morning, noon, and evening. These medicine bottles 20 are placed sequentially in the storage holes 6 of the medicine tray 4 according to the rotation direction of the motor 5. At the time of each dosage time, the motor 5 rotates the medicine tray 4 by a predetermined angle, causing the corresponding medicine bottle 20 to fall from the drop outlet 3. After falling, the medicine bottle 20 presses onto the receiving plate 8. Under the influence of gravity, the receiving plate 8 moves downward and triggers the button switch 9, causing the speaker 10 to activate. The speaker 10 then emits a voice reminder for the elderly person to take their medication. The button switch 9 is turned off only when the elderly person removes the medicine bottle 20 from the receiving plate 8, and the speaker 10 stops working. Therefore, this medication dispensing device not only automatically and accurately provides the elderly person with medication on time but also reminds them to take their medication, achieving the purpose of automatic and accurate medication dispensing and intelligent reminders, preventing situations where the elderly person forgets to take their medication or takes it incorrectly.

[0032] like Figure 4As shown in this exemplary embodiment, the receiving reminder component also includes a receiving slot 12 with an open upper end, placed on the base 1. A receiving plate 8 and a push-button switch 9 are both located within the receiving slot 12. The internal space of the receiving slot 12 is smaller at the top and larger at the bottom. The push-button switch 9 and the receiving plate 8 are both arranged in the lower space within the receiving slot 12. A spring 11 is installed at the bottom of the receiving plate 8, and the push-button switch 9 is located inside the spring 11 and directly below the receiving plate 8. The upper opening of the receiving slot 12 is aligned with the medicine dropper 3 of the medicine storage chamber 2. When the medicine bottle 20 falls from the medicine dropper 3, it falls onto the receiving plate 8 within the receiving slot 12, pushing the receiving plate 8 downwards. The receiving plate 8 triggers the push-button switch 9 to activate the speaker 10. The design of the receiving slot 12 effectively restricts the position of the medicine bottle 20 on the receiving plate 8, preventing the medicine bottle 20 from slipping off the receiving plate 8, thereby ensuring that the speaker 10 can be turned on smoothly to remind the user that the medicine is ready.

[0033] like Figure 5 As shown in this exemplary embodiment, the receiving plate 8 is made of iron, and a permanent magnet 7 is provided at the bottom of the medicine bottle 20. This arrangement ensures that when the medicine bottle 20 falls onto the receiving plate 8, it is magnetically attracted to the plate, preventing it from being ejected from the receiving slot 12 by the spring force of the spring 11. This allows the medicine bottle 20 to land more stably in the receiving slot 12, preventing accidental slippage and improving the stability and reliability of the entire dispensing device.

[0034] like Figure 2 and Figure 4 As shown in this exemplary embodiment, a battery is embedded in the base 1. The battery is a rechargeable battery 13 with a charging interface that extends to the outside of the base 1 (not shown in the figure). The rechargeable battery 13 can not only power the motor 5, speaker 10, and other electrical devices, but also allows the dispensing device to store electricity and operate normally without being plugged in, thereby improving ease of use. This means that users can use the device anywhere without worrying about power supply issues. Of course, in other embodiments, the base 1 can also be provided with a battery slot for installing dry batteries to adapt to different usage scenarios and needs, providing users with more options.

[0035] like Figure 2 and Figure 4 As shown in this exemplary embodiment, the top of the medicine storage chamber 2 is open, and a top cover 15 is rotatably connected to the opening at the top of the medicine storage chamber 2 via a pivot 14. This configuration not only allows the user to easily open the top cover 15 and conveniently place the medicine bottle 20 into the medicine storage hole 6 of the medicine tray rack 4 through the opening at the top of the medicine storage chamber 2, but also improves the reusability of the medicine dispensing device. Users can easily replenish the medication after each use, thereby promoting the reuse of the medicine dispensing device.

[0036] like Figure 5 As shown in this exemplary embodiment, the medicine bottle 20 includes a bottle body 200 and a rubber stopper 201. The bottle body 200 has an open top, and the rubber stopper 201 is elastically secured to the opening at the top of the bottle body 200. This design ensures the airtightness of the bottle body 200, preventing the medicine inside from getting damp, thereby effectively protecting the quality of the medicine and extending its shelf life.

[0037] Example 2: See Figures 6 to 8 Based on Example 1, in this embodiment, a bottom support component is provided at the position corresponding to each medicine storage hole 6. The bottom support component includes a connecting rod 16, a rotating rod 17, and a torsion spring 18. The first end of the connecting rod 16 is fixedly connected to the medicine tray frame 4, and the rotating rod 17 is rotatably connected to the second end of the connecting rod 16. The torsion spring 18 is located at the rotatable connection position of the connecting rod 16 and the rotating rod 17. A stop bar 19 corresponding to the position of the rotating rod 17 is fixedly provided in the medicine storage cavity 2. Specifically, the rotating rod 17 has an A end and a B end, the connecting rod 16 is connected between the A end and the B end, and the stop bar 19 is located near the medicine dispensing port 3. Under normal conditions, end A of the rotating rod 17 is held at the bottom of the medicine bottle 20 by the elastic force of the torsion spring 18. End A of the rotating rod 17 lifts the bottom of the medicine bottle 20 upwards, preventing the bottom of the medicine bottle 20 from contacting the bottom of the medicine storage cavity 2. This prevents wear on the bottom of the medicine bottle 20 during the rotation of the medicine tray frame 4. When the medicine bottle 20 rotates above the medicine drop outlet 3, the stop bar 19 fixed in the medicine storage cavity 2 blocks end B of the rotating rod 17. After end B of the rotating rod 17 is blocked, as the medicine tray frame 4 rotates further, the rotating rod 17 rotates around the connecting rod 16 until end A of the rotating rod 17 is removed from the bottom of the medicine bottle 20. This allows the medicine bottle 20 to fall downwards from the medicine storage hole 6 of the medicine tray frame 4 and finally out of the medicine drop outlet 3. Through the above design, wear on the bottom of the medicine bottle 20 can be avoided while ensuring that the medicine bottle 20 falls accurately from the medicine drop outlet 3.
